Dead Battery

Your key fob's battery is responsible for providing the remote functions that allow you to unlock your car, open the tailgate or trunk and start your engine. But, as with all batteries, the key fob battery eventually dies. This can cause chaos and disrupt your day.

Fortunately, you don't have to wait for your key fob to break down before you can replace the battery. It's easy enough to do at home, which means you don't have to pay an expert mechanic to replace your key fob's batteries.

The first step is inspect the key fob for a slot or notch along the seam that divides the top and bottom of the fob. Make use of a coin or flathead screwdriver to insert into this slot and then gently the fob's two halves. Once you've loosened the fob, pull out the old battery and then insert the new one in its place. After you've inserted the new battery, snap the fob halves together and test it. If the key fob won't unlock your car or start it then try holding the fob closer to the ignition switch. The radio transmitter inside the key fob is able to transmit a signal to the vehicle's onboard receiver even from just a few feet away, but it only works when there's a battery-powered remote within close proximity to the ignition.

Damaged Circuit Board

A damaged circuit board could impact the performance and integrity of the device. It can also cause problems with the functioning of other components and parts on the device. There are a variety of ways to repair damaged circuits. Using these techniques you can restore the functionality of your device and make it look like new.

First, examine the device to determine the cause of the damage. This is especially important if you're trying to troubleshoot an complicated circuit board. You should note any burn marks on the circuit board or any other physical damages. Also, you should test the voltage at various locations on the board. This can be done using a multimeter or an oscilloscope in accordance with the complexity of the circuit board.

Circuit boards that are damaged are typically caused by malfunctioning components. They could be things such as a defective diode or a transistor. In some instances the issue could be caused by a damaged trace path. Traces are made of copper or silver and are susceptible to being damaged by physical damage, severe power surges, metallic dust contamination, and normal wear and tear.

Before you attempt to repair a circuit board it is essential to make sure that you have the necessary tools and materials. This will ensure that the repair goes as smooth as it can be. For instance, you must have a soldering gun, sandpaper, and a desoldering device.  fob repair near me  should also protect yourself from electrostatic discharges which can damage circuit boards. To prevent ESD you can connect your workstation to the ground or use an antistatic wrist strap.

Finally, it is important to clean the circuit board prior to starting the repair process. This will help prevent further damage and will reduce the chance of the chance of errors. To clean a circuit board, you can use a swab that is soaked in isopropyl alcohol (IPA) or a flux remover pen. Also, make sure that the soldering pads are clean and free from contaminants.

Key fobs are small electronic device that allows access to and control of a vehicle's functions without using the physical key. Key fobs are subject to many abuses and are not impervious to destruction. They also have a variety of parts that can fail or be damaged. Most of these parts are repairable. Contacts to the battery terminal and buttons are the most frequently encountered failure point however, there are other issues that could happen.

Car key fobs communicate with the vehicle via radio frequency. They have distinct tags on them that match up with the car, and when pressed they relay the information from the tag to the vehicle so it can open or lock the door, or even start the engine. A car key fob is more useful than traditional keys that require being in the ignition to enable the features.

It can be a bit confusing when your car key fob stops working. Luckily, most issues with a key fob are not urgent and can be fixed at home. Cleaning the batteries or changing the batteries could be all that's needed to solve the problem with your car key fob.

It is crucial to note that if you've tried all of these tricks and your key fob still isn't working, it could be time to replace it. The purchase of a new key fob can be more practical than trying to figure out what is wrong with your current key fob, and it is much safer than having no way to operate your vehicle.

You can buy a replacement key fob from the dealer or auto locksmith, based on the make and the model of your car. The dealer can also modify the new key fob to your particular vehicle.



Certain car makers offer apps that you can download on your smartphone to allow you to unlock the doors and start the engine in the event that you lose your key fob or isn't working. This is a solution for those with a spare key fob and who want to keep their car secure while they fix the broken one.
